The Cortex Innovation Community is a hub of innovation and technology established in St. Louis in 2002. Now home to over 350 technology-related companies, the complete renovation of 4340 Duncan (the historic Crescent building) became the new home to BioSTL, Confluence, and other bio- and medical technology companies. RBLD partnered with HOK and Ross & Baruzzini to design interior and exterior lighting for the renovated 4-story, 85,000-square-foot multi-tenant office and laboratory space. The 2-story glass-enclosed lab and adjacent grand stair are prominent features in the core of the building. High laboratory light levels were achieved by ambient light and task lights at lab benches.

Because budget and flexibility were top priorities, selecting an economical building-standard fixture and applying it throughout the project as a pendant, recessed, or wall-mounted linear LED served to simplify and unify the spaces. The RBLD team also painstakingly organized and tagged the porcelain industrial fixtures from the original building to be selectively restored and reused throughout the facility.
